            7.2.2   Characteristics of EHM rehabilitation services

            1)      Access to data produced by EHMT and EHMH services
            EHMR services may benefit from accessing data which have been produced by EHMH and EHMT
            services.

            2)      Restricted service coverage
            EHMR services may be provided to users in qualified locations.
            NOTE 1 – Inside qualified service buildings, users can usually obtain EHMR services with full capabilities.
            In other locations, users may access EHMR services with partial capabilities.
            3)      Support of clinical intervention

            EHMR services provide support for clinical intervention to users.
            4)      Data transmission with high reliability requirements and medium latency constraints

            EHMR services need data transmission with high reliability and which allows medium latency.
            –       Data of EHMR services are transmitted without faults.
            –       EHMR  services  have  a  stricter  latency  requirement  than  EHMH  services,  but  a  looser
                    latency requirement than EHMT services.
            7.2.3   Characteristics of EHM treatment services

            1)      Centralized management
            EHMT services have usually centralized management inside organizations providing these services.

            2)      Medical imaging
            Medical imaging devices used in EHMT services, such as CT, MRI, ultrasonic devices and so on,
            usually generate big data streams.
            –       Big data streams are generated among departments inside a hospital or among hospitals, as
                    well  as  between  hospital  and  emergency  cars,  and  between  disaster  sites  and  hospital
                    or emergency cars.
            3)      Data transmission with high reliability and low latency requirements

            EHMT services need data transmission with high reliability and low latency requirements.
            –       EHMT services have the highest requirements of latency compared to EHMH and EHMR
                    services.
